Agistment Services
Close-Knit Alpacas is happy to announce that we are now offering Boarding & Agistment services. Our farm offers fourteen separate alpaca yards, with shelter and/or barn facilities to accommodate the needs of breeding females, new crias & their moms, weanlings, yearling males, jr. herd sires, herd sires, geldings/fiber boys, companion females & a quarantine building. We also have a large 65' round-pen & miles of nature trails for walks & training sessions with your alpacas. Our trailer has a wireless camera system, for added peace of mind while transporting any alpacas for any reason. Dr. Grant Seaman, DVM is our camelid veterinarian. Emergency situations requiring a hospital and more intensive, critical care will be handled by Dr. Mary Smith, camelid specialist for Cornell University. We are only 1hr. 15 min.s drive from Cornell.
